             + ]H[ + ---:--- + ]H[ Edge of Night #32 ]H[ + ---:--- + ]H[ +

Somewhere in the Spirit Lands:

     "Okay," Cloudrider said, "so we work on Uncle Wolf's project."  He looked around
at the dim landscape of ferny plains.  "How do we do that?"
     Young Joan closed her eyes; he guessed she was consulting her ghost partner,
Selumia.  "There should be a....  Damn, it isn't clear at all.  A zone of
transition."
     Cloudrider looked around, pointedly.  There was no variation in the scenery in
any direction.
     "There will be such a zone when we expect it to be there," Nightwind said in the
back of Cloudrider's mind.  "The geography here is not fixed as it appears in the
Outer Lands.  Expectation and belief are critical."
     "Okay," Joan said, and he figured she must have heard the same thing from her
ghost.  "We're climbing a long hill here, and when we get to the top, we'll see the
zone of transition beyond it."
     Looking at the ferny ground ahead of him, Cloudrider saw that it was, indeed, a
long slope with a crest somewhere ahead.  He could almost see a top to it.  This was
a relief, to have a definite, clear goal.  "So, let's get walking," he said.

     The two not-humans, the nighthunter and the other, looked up as Blackwind and
Agro approached.  Blackwind had an idea that hot words had been exchanged, something
in their postures hinted at hostile confrontation between them.  Maybe that would
work in their--his and Agro's and Redfox's--favor, that their enemies weren't likely
to combine against them.  Or maybe the living versus whatever was a stronger factor.
Trying to calculate all the angles made his head ache.
     The taller creature, the Other, fixed a burning gaze on the gladiator from
Malcorn.  Literally burning, it felt like.  Blackwind wondered how long it would take
for his face to blister from the heat.  "Why are you here?" the Other asked.
     The nighthunter laid a paw on Redfox, extending its claws like a cat.  "This is
MINE," it whined, "you bound it, that proves it was meant for sacrifice even without
the Words!"
     The Other's face changed color, going from a not-really-human sort of mauve to
near-black, and its eyes dilated and glowed hotter as it turned on the nighthunter,
teeth--fangs--bared.  "You dared?  You have broken the ancient contract, and you
dared to involve ME in this transgression?"
     The claws flexed and dug in, drawing blood.  "This is MINE!" it said again.
Whining, protesting, obstinate as the stupid and fearful can be.
     The Other roared something in a language the gladiators didn't recognize.  The
nighthunter burst into flames and fled, wailing and screeching, with lingering shouts
of, "MINE!"
     "That is a fool, as it has always been," the Other said.  "But you set a trap
for it, did you not?"
     Blackwind remembered advice from long ago:  if you don't know what lies will go
over, tell the truth.  "Yeah, we did," he said.  "What we were told, things were
getting out of hand, rules were being broken.  We wanted... names."
     "And that gave you mine?"
     "If your name is Arhazul, yeah.  The name was mentioned."
     "A fool, and always a fool.  I will unmake it.  But that is for later enjoyment.
You have my name, one of them.  You have found me.  What do you intend to try here?"
     It occurred to Blackwind that the Other had never once looked at Agro, or
addressed the Croc, and maybe it couldn't even see the cold-blooded gladiator?  Maybe
it thought the "we" referred only to himself and Redfox.  Interesting, but no time to
test it right now.  "Don't know," he said, shrugging.  It was damned hard to maintain
the casual attitude, but he had an idea it was the right one here.  "We were just
told to gather information.  Someone's been messing with, I didn't get this exactly,
but with the way people's souls travel after they die?  Something like that.  We were
sent out to get some names."
     "And that gave you mine?"  The Other seemed to swell with wrath.  "I will unmake
it slowly and use the parts after in ways it will die to regret.  But to you I say, I
swear on the Crimson Gates of Hell, I have not been 'messing' with the movement of
souls.  There are certain rules to which all agree, that existence may continue.  I
do not transgress them."
     And the worst of that was, Blackwind believed it.  Whatever was going on with
the souls, this Other was not part of the problem.
     "Who dared suggest that I might be involved?"
     "Eh?  Well, that nighthunter you chased off.  It was the first one to mention
your name."
     "Not enough.  Who sent you to ASK that one?"
     Oh, shit.  Feuds among the immortal demons?  JUST what they needed to get sucked
into.  Blackwind hesitated.  Maybe he could finesse this--
     "It was a Dark Stranger from the Silent Place near Zuwayza," Redfox said.  His
voice was hoarse but steady.
     A sizzling sound.  The Other, too angry even to swear promises of retribution,
fury coming off it like waves of heat off a forge.  "Silent Place!" it said finally.
"It will be silent no longer.  There will be screams!  THEY traffic in souls, never
doubt it, and it is THEY who are breaking the Rules!  THEY will pay for this infamy."
     "Yes, well, we can take that message back to the people in charge--"
     "What people are in charge?  How can humans interfere in this?"
     "Whoever's doing it is interfering with humans," Blackwind pointed out.  "Only
reasonable we should try to get it straightened out."
     "Who?"
     "Well... Lord Malcorn, and...."
     "Oh.  Yes, the Malcorn... He would.  Yes.  He has the right, and a right is also
a duty.  He would involve Himself, He must."  The flaming eyes narrowed.  "And He
will see to it that the blame falls on the guilty, and not on those such as myself
who have kept the agreements.  Yes."  A decisive nod.  "I will conduct my own
investigation into this transgression, and you will aid me, human."
     "Ah...."
     "I will make it a bargain, according to the rules.  The life of this one," it
lifted Redfox easily and shook him as a child might shake a doll, "in return for your
aid."
     "Ah, don't these rules say you can't kill him without permission?"
     A mouth full of fangs, in what might be a smile.  "I cannot KILL him, take him
as a sacrifice, without the Words, but any mortal astray in this realm is at risk of
other things.  Many other things.  Which I could do, if I wish, without any Words
being spoken.  Because his presence here at all is a kind of permission."
     "That sounds a lot like the argument that nighthunter was making."
     "The cases differ.  That one was in your world, but you are in MY world.  It
makes a difference, you see it?"
     "Yeah."  Boy, did Blackwind see it.  They were all over a barrel here.  Not just
Redfox, he himself was here where he was at risk of the 'many other things', and Agro
as well, if the Other ever figured the Croc was present.  "Okay, I guess I don't like
the other choice much, so, what do you want us to do?"

             + ]H[ + ---:--- + ]H[ Edge of Night #33 ]H[ + ---:--- + ]H[ +

     "It is these weasels from the Silent Place who have disturbed the balances,"
Arhazul said after a moment's thought.  "AND one of theirs who set you astray in
search of me and mine.  So.  They must be--"
     "We were told that there were out-of-control necromancers involved in this,"
Blackwind said.  He edged close enough to free Redfox's hands.
     "No doubt.  Humans will always meddle, it's what you do, is it not?  Even now,
you are meddling with ME.  But it is those eaters of souls at the Silent Place who
are MY concern, and if you would ever return to your own world, you will aid me as I
demand in dealing with MY enemies."
     "I guess we don't have much choice," Blackwind said again.  "Except... we won't
do anything that is going to mess up OUR world, you know."
     Arhazul waved what must be a hand, though the fingers were too long and thin and
it had claws instead of nails, still, more a hand than a paw.  Better not get in the
habit of thinking of this entity as an animal.  "That is understood.  We each have
our own agenda, that is the human phrase, is it not?  And we will each attempt to get
the best balance for our own purposes.  A struggle, but with rules.  It will be
amusing."
     "Amusing?"
     "Certainly.  To be what you call a 'demon' and live here doing what is
available, it becomes boring after a few eons.  A new activity is always welcome.
But come, we must begin."  It paused, clicking its clawed digits against each other.
After a moment, it said, "Yes, first--Chorzelan.  It will be a journey, I do not
consider it a long one.  You must be alert, there are dangers--for me as well as for
you."  The fangs flashed in something that might have been a grin.  "And if anything
happens to me, you will never get out of this world, nor will you long escape others
who might not have my scruples.  Therefore think with care before you consider
betraying me."
     "We've said we'd work with you," Blackwind answered sharply.  "That counts as an
oath in my book, and we aren't traitors."

     The half hour till moonrise seemed one of the longest Math op Owain had ever
experienced, and at the same time, one of the shortest.  No one spoke.  Once the
horses were saddled, they simply stood, each by his own mount, waiting for moonrise.
It was overcast, at least, Math could see no stars.  How would they even know when
the moon rose?  He opened his mouth to ask, looked around at his companions in the
light of the single candle, and changed his mind.  Lord Malcorn, Uncle Wolf, the Dark
Stranger--not people he wanted to question.  What was he, an ordinary human
gladiator, no longer young, doing in the company of these... powers?  He would be
glad to get out of this, go home, forget the whole business.  His feet were cold
clear up to his armpits.  But he didn't think he could find the way back from here,
and with strange beasts howling in the woods, he wasn't going to wander off on his
own.
     And then the moon rose.
     Math couldn't see the moon, but light shot into the mausoleum from somewhere,
and Lord Malcorn was chanting words of power, and the inner door opened with a sound
of stone grinding on stone.
     Malcorn stepped through the doorway, leading his horse.  The Dark Stranger
hesitated, and Uncle Wolf crowded against him, forcing him to enter next.  Then the
shaman.  And Math wasn't going to stay here by himself.  He grabbed his horse's
bridle as much for the comfort of its large, warm presence as to make sure it came
along, and walked toward the inner door.
